Nebeus, is a cryptocurrency app from Spain that provides a whole ecosystem of crypto services allowing people to borrow, earn, exchange, and insure their digital assets. One of the most used Nebeus services is crypto-backed loans: a service that allows Nebeus users to instantly borrow stablecoins (USDT or USDC) or Fiat money (GBP, EUR, or USD) without selling their cryptocurrency. 

Crypto-backed loans are loans that people can secure using their cryptocurrencies as collateral. The demand for such loans has increased dramatically in the past two years as you can hold onto your assets and get instant money. Crypto-backed loans enable people to do more with their crypto, such as:

  • Diversify their crypto portfolios by purchasing more cryptocurrencies.
  • Fund their ambitions and pay for significant expenses, such as mortgage down payments and much more.
  • Finance their businesses.
  • And even help with smaller daily expenses.

What is AVAX?

Avalanche is a platform that allows anyone to build custom decentralised applications (dApps) powered by the AVAX coin. Avalanche also allows:

  • Developers to create custom blockchains (subnets) where they have complete control over privacy rules.
  • 4,500 transactions per second, compared to Bitcoin’s maximum of 7.

What is XRP?

Ripple (XRP) has a clear goal: to tackle expensive and slow international transfers. So, XRP allows financial institutions and banks to transfer coins globally, quickly, and with minimal costs.

Compared to Bitcoin, XRP:

  • Handles over 1,500 transactions per second, compared to Bitcoin’s maximum of 7.
  • Is more environmentally friendly as no mining is required.

What is LTC?

Litecoin (LTC) is very similar to Bitcoin. However, there are some key differences:

  • It’s 4 times faster, processing a block every 2.5 minutes.
  • The max circulating supply is four times larger: 84M compared to 21M BTC.

What is BCH?

Bitcoin Cash (BCH) is a spin-off fork of Bitcoin that works towards Bitcoin’s initial promise to be true and usable digital money. BCH also:

  • Increased its block sizes from 1MB to 32MB to improve transaction speeds.
  • Is versatile as it offers almost instant, low-fee transactions, and it is currently used in over 5,000 physical places worldwide.

What is DASH?

Dash (DASH) is a cryptocurrency that branched off Bitcoin’s blockchain. It has similar uses to Bitcoin, but has a greater focus on privacy. Dash also:

  • Keeps your transactions anonymous, preventing anyone from accessing sensitive information.
  • Has instant global transfers that take a few seconds, compared to Bitcoin’s processing time which ranges from 10 minutes to an hour.

What is XLM?

Stellar Lumens (XLM) is the cryptocurrency used by the Stellar blockchain, founded by Jed McCaleb, one of the Ripple co-founders. Instead of helping banks as Ripple does, Lumens help individuals become part of the global economy. Compared to Ripple:

  • It is a non-profit organisation so it is focused on helping people, not just making a profit.
  • XLM benefits those in developing countries to become more empowered with their money.

What is EOS?

EOS (EOS) is a developer-focused blockchain platform designed to facilitate fast, configurable, and scalable projects supported by the EOS cryptocurrency. Additionally:

  • EOS provides tools, guidance, funds to community dApp proposals, and educational courses to support their community constantly.
  • It sustains itself as it rewards users constantly for their work.
